Extrasensory Perception (ESP)
Gaining information about objects, events, or another person’s thoughts through some means other than the known sensory channels.
Relative Size
A perceptual clue which allows a person to see or understand the size of an object in comparison to other objects in the environment, contributing to the perception of depth.
Monocular Cues
Visual signals that allow for depth perception and distance estimation from a single eye.
Depth Perception
is the visual ability to perceive the world in three dimensions (3D) and to understand spatial relationships.
